Hi

I'm trying to open a floppy disc but it's telling me the disc isn't
formatted and won't let me open it. If I click on format now it says all the
info will be lost, if I ignore, it just won't open. I've tried copying the
disc but I can't do that either.
I can't afford to lose the info on this disc! I'm panicking now!
 
Try the disk in another pc and see if you can open it, otherwise try open it
on a win98/dos pc. I find that dos can sometimes open a disk that windows
cannot as it doesnt try to read the whole disk, and then copy the file you
need.

The following may apply:


Floppy Disk is Not Accessible, Not Formatted, or Not Recognized by Windows



http://support.microsoft.com/default.aspx?scid=kb;en-us;140060&Product=winxp





If the above does apply and you have files on the floppy, then you need to
find a computer with an older version of Windows that can open the floppy.
Copy the files to the hard drive and then copy the files back to a floppy
formatted with Windows XP {or at least an updated format}.
